Deep Learning Icons
Deep Learning Icons

What is Artificial Intelligence, Machine Learning, and Deep Learning?

Artificial intelligence, machine learning, and deep learning are revolutionizing industries, and at LEARNS.EDU.VN, we’re here to demystify these powerful technologies for everyone. This article will explore the definitions, differences, and applications of these transformative concepts. With clear explanations, real-world examples, and the latest advancements, discover how these fields are shaping our future and how you can learn more through our resources.

1. Understanding Artificial Intelligence (AI): The Broad Scope

1.1. What is Artificial Intelligence?

Artificial Intelligence (AI) is the broad concept of machines mimicking human intelligence. This involves creating systems that can perform tasks that typically require human intelligence, such as learning, problem-solving, decision-making, and understanding natural language. AI aims to develop machines that can think and act rationally, adapting to new situations and solving complex problems autonomously.

1.2. Historical Roots and Evolution of AI

AI’s journey began in the mid-20th century, with the Dartmouth Workshop in 1956 often cited as its official birth. Early AI research focused on symbolic reasoning and problem-solving.

Era Key Developments Challenges
1950s – 1960s Development of early AI programs like ELIZA and Logic Theorist Limited computing power, overestimation of AI’s potential
1970s – 1980s AI Winter: Funding cuts due to unmet expectations Lack of practical applications, algorithmic limitations
1990s – 2000s Expert systems, machine learning algorithms emerge Data scarcity, computational constraints
2010s – Present Deep learning revolution, AI integration into various industries Ethical concerns, bias in algorithms

1.3. Types of Artificial Intelligence: Narrow vs. General AI

Artificial Intelligence is categorized into two main types:

  • Narrow or Weak AI: Designed to perform a specific task, like spam filtering, facial recognition, or playing chess.
  • General or Strong AI: Possesses human-level intelligence, capable of understanding, learning, and implementing knowledge across various domains.

1.4. Real-World Applications of AI Across Industries

AI applications are transforming industries worldwide. Here are a few examples:

  • Healthcare: AI-powered diagnostic tools, personalized treatment plans, robotic surgery.
  • Finance: Fraud detection, algorithmic trading, risk assessment.
  • Transportation: Autonomous vehicles, traffic management systems, route optimization.
  • Retail: Personalized shopping recommendations, inventory management, chatbot customer service.
  • Education: Personalized learning platforms, automated grading, AI tutors.

2. Diving into Machine Learning (ML): A Subset of AI

2.1. What is Machine Learning?

Machine Learning (ML) is a subset of AI that focuses on enabling systems to learn from data without being explicitly programmed. ML algorithms allow computers to improve their performance on a specific task as they are exposed to more data. This learning process involves identifying patterns, making predictions, and adapting to new information.

2.2. How Machine Learning Differs from Traditional Programming

Traditional programming relies on explicit rules and instructions, while machine learning uses algorithms to learn patterns from data.

Feature Traditional Programming Machine Learning
Approach Explicitly coded rules Learning from data
Data Dependency Limited High
Adaptability Low High
Use Cases Well-defined problems Complex, data-rich problems
Example Calculating simple interest Predicting customer churn

2.3. Types of Machine Learning Algorithms: Supervised, Unsupervised, and Reinforcement Learning

There are primarily three types of machine learning algorithms:

  • Supervised Learning: Trains a model on labeled data to make predictions or classifications. Examples include linear regression, decision trees, and support vector machines.
  • Unsupervised Learning: Identifies patterns and structures in unlabeled data. Examples include clustering, dimensionality reduction, and association rule mining.
  • Reinforcement Learning: Trains an agent to make decisions in an environment to maximize a reward. Examples include Q-learning and deep Q-networks.

2.4. Practical Examples of Machine Learning in Daily Life

Machine learning is embedded in many aspects of daily life:

  • Recommendation Systems: Netflix, Amazon, and Spotify use ML to suggest movies, products, and music.
  • Spam Filters: Email services use ML to identify and filter spam.
  • Fraud Detection: Banks use ML to detect fraudulent transactions.
  • Voice Assistants: Siri, Alexa, and Google Assistant use ML for voice recognition and natural language processing.
  • Medical Diagnosis: ML algorithms assist in diagnosing diseases from medical images and patient data.

3. Exploring Deep Learning (DL): A More Advanced Approach to ML

3.1. What is Deep Learning?

Deep Learning (DL) is a subset of machine learning that uses artificial neural networks with multiple layers (hence “deep”) to analyze data. These neural networks are inspired by the structure and function of the human brain, allowing DL models to learn complex patterns and representations from large amounts of data.

3.2. The Role of Neural Networks in Deep Learning

Neural networks consist of interconnected nodes (neurons) organized in layers. Each connection between neurons has a weight, which is adjusted during the learning process.

Component Description
Neurons Basic units that perform calculations
Layers Organize neurons into input, hidden, and output layers
Weights Adjust the strength of connections between neurons
Activation Functions Introduce non-linearity, enabling complex pattern learning

3.3. How Deep Learning Differs from Traditional Machine Learning

Deep learning automates feature extraction, reducing the need for manual feature engineering.

Feature Traditional Machine Learning Deep Learning
Feature Extraction Manual Automatic
Data Dependency Moderate High
Computational Needs Lower Higher
Complexity Lower Higher
Use Cases Simpler problems Complex, high-dimensional problems

3.4. Breakthrough Applications of Deep Learning in Recent Years

Deep learning has enabled significant breakthroughs in various fields:

  • Image Recognition: Object detection, facial recognition, image classification.
  • Natural Language Processing (NLP): Language translation, sentiment analysis, chatbots.
  • Speech Recognition: Voice assistants, transcription services, voice search.
  • Autonomous Driving: Object detection, lane keeping, traffic sign recognition.
  • Drug Discovery: Identifying potential drug candidates, predicting drug efficacy.

4. The Interplay Between AI, ML, and DL: A Visual Representation

4.1. AI as the Overarching Concept

Artificial Intelligence (AI) is the broad concept encompassing machines mimicking human intelligence. It’s the overarching goal of creating systems that can perform tasks that typically require human intelligence.

4.2. Machine Learning as a Method to Achieve AI

Machine Learning (ML) is a subset of AI that uses algorithms to learn from data without being explicitly programmed. It provides the tools and techniques to enable machines to learn and improve from experience.

4.3. Deep Learning as a Technique for Implementing ML

Deep Learning (DL) is a subset of ML that uses artificial neural networks with multiple layers to analyze data. It’s a powerful technique that has enabled significant breakthroughs in various fields, such as image recognition and natural language processing.

4.4. Visualizing the Relationship: Concentric Circles

Imagine three concentric circles to understand their relationship:

  1. Outer Circle: AI – The broadest concept.
  2. Middle Circle: ML – A subset of AI.
  3. Inner Circle: DL – A subset of ML.

This visualization helps clarify that all deep learning is machine learning, and all machine learning is artificial intelligence, but not all AI is machine learning, and not all machine learning is deep learning.

5. The Rise of AI: From Bust to Boom

5.1. Historical Fluctuations in AI Development

AI’s journey has been marked by periods of excitement followed by disillusionment.

Phase Timeframe Characteristics
Early Enthusiasm 1950s – 1960s Optimism about AI’s potential, early AI programs
AI Winter 1970s – 1980s Funding cuts due to unmet expectations
Resurgence 1990s – 2000s Expert systems and machine learning algorithms emerge
AI Boom 2010s – Present Deep learning revolution, widespread AI applications

5.2. Key Factors Driving the Current AI Boom

Several factors have contributed to the recent surge in AI:

  • Increased Computing Power: The development of powerful GPUs has made parallel processing faster and more efficient.
  • Big Data Availability: The exponential growth of data provides the raw material for training AI models.
  • Algorithmic Advancements: Deep learning and other algorithms have significantly improved AI performance.
  • Investment and Funding: Increased investment in AI research and development has fueled innovation.

5.3. The Impact of GPUs on Deep Learning Performance

GPUs (Graphics Processing Units) have revolutionized deep learning by enabling parallel processing, which significantly reduces the time required to train complex neural networks. According to a study by NVIDIA, using GPUs can accelerate deep learning training by up to 100x compared to CPUs.

5.4. The Role of Big Data in Training AI Models

Big Data provides the vast amounts of data needed to train AI models effectively. The more data an AI model is trained on, the more accurate and reliable it becomes. For example, large datasets of images have enabled deep learning models to achieve human-level performance in image recognition.

6. Artificial Intelligence: Human Intelligence Exhibited by Machines

6.1. Defining Human Intelligence in the Context of AI

Human intelligence in the context of AI refers to the ability of machines to perform tasks that typically require human cognitive skills, such as learning, reasoning, problem-solving, perception, and natural language understanding.

6.2. The Concept of General AI: The Ultimate Goal

General AI, or strong AI, aims to create machines that possess human-level intelligence. These machines would be capable of understanding, learning, and implementing knowledge across various domains, much like a human. While general AI remains a long-term goal, advancements in narrow AI are paving the way for future breakthroughs.

6.3. Narrow AI: Technologies that Excel at Specific Tasks

Narrow AI, or weak AI, is designed to perform specific tasks as well as or better than humans. Examples of narrow AI include image classification, facial recognition, and spam filtering. These technologies exhibit specific facets of human intelligence but lack the general cognitive abilities of humans.

6.4. Examples of Narrow AI in Practice: Image Classification and Face Recognition

  • Image Classification: Services like Pinterest use AI to classify images, making it easier for users to find and organize content.
  • Face Recognition: Platforms like Facebook use AI to recognize faces in photos, enabling users to tag friends and family.

7. Machine Learning: An Approach to Achieve Artificial Intelligence

7.1. The Core Principles of Machine Learning

Machine learning is based on the principle of using algorithms to parse data, learn from it, and then make a determination or prediction about something in the world. Instead of hand-coding software routines with a specific set of instructions, the machine is “trained” using large amounts of data and algorithms that give it the ability to learn how to perform the task.

7.2. Key Machine Learning Algorithms and Techniques

Over the years, several machine learning algorithms and techniques have been developed, including:

  • Decision Tree Learning: Building decision trees to classify or predict outcomes based on input features.
  • Inductive Logic Programming: Using logic programming to discover patterns and rules from data.
  • Clustering: Grouping similar data points together to identify patterns and structures.
  • Reinforcement Learning: Training an agent to make decisions in an environment to maximize a reward.
  • Bayesian Networks: Using probabilistic graphical models to represent dependencies between variables.

7.3. The Role of Data in Machine Learning

Data is the lifeblood of machine learning. The more data a machine learning model is trained on, the more accurate and reliable it becomes. Data is used to train the model, validate its performance, and fine-tune its parameters.

7.4. Computer Vision: An Early Success Story for Machine Learning

Computer vision, the field of enabling computers to “see” and interpret images, was one of the early success stories for machine learning. Early approaches to computer vision involved hand-coding classifiers to detect edges, shapes, and objects in images. However, these approaches were brittle and prone to error.

8. Deep Learning: A Technique for Implementing Machine Learning

8.1. The Architecture of Artificial Neural Networks

Artificial neural networks are inspired by the structure of the human brain. They consist of interconnected nodes (neurons) organized in layers. Each connection between neurons has a weight, which is adjusted during the learning process.

8.2. The Layers in a Neural Network: Input, Hidden, and Output

A typical neural network consists of three types of layers:

  • Input Layer: Receives the input data.
  • Hidden Layers: Perform complex calculations and feature extraction.
  • Output Layer: Produces the final output or prediction.

8.3. How Neurons Process and Weight Inputs

Each neuron assigns a weighting to its input, indicating how correct or incorrect it is relative to the task being performed. The final output is determined by the total of those weightings.

8.4. The Importance of Training and Tuning Neural Networks

Neural networks need to be trained and tuned to perform effectively. Training involves exposing the network to large amounts of data and adjusting the weights of the connections between neurons. Tuning involves optimizing the network’s parameters to achieve the best possible performance.

9. Thanks to Deep Learning, AI Has a Bright Future

9.1. The Impact of Deep Learning on AI Applications

Deep learning has enabled many practical applications of machine learning and, by extension, the overall field of AI. Deep learning breaks down tasks in ways that make all kinds of machine assists seem possible, even likely.

9.2. Key Applications Enabled by Deep Learning: Driverless Cars, Healthcare, and More

  • Driverless Cars: Deep learning enables cars to detect objects, recognize traffic signs, and navigate roads autonomously.
  • Healthcare: Deep learning assists in diagnosing diseases, personalizing treatment plans, and discovering new drugs.
  • Movie Recommendations: Deep learning powers recommendation systems that suggest movies based on user preferences.

9.3. The Future of AI: Towards Science Fiction Realities

With the help of deep learning, AI may even get to that science fiction state we’ve so long imagined. Driverless cars, better preventive healthcare, even better movie recommendations, are all here today or on the horizon. AI is the present and the future.

9.4. Ethical Considerations and Challenges in AI Development

As AI becomes more prevalent, it’s important to address ethical considerations and challenges, such as bias in algorithms, privacy concerns, and job displacement. Developing AI responsibly requires careful attention to these issues and a commitment to fairness, transparency, and accountability.

10. Frequently Asked Questions (FAQs) About AI, ML, and DL

10.1. What is the difference between AI, ML, and DL?

AI is the broad concept of machines mimicking human intelligence. ML is a subset of AI that uses algorithms to learn from data. DL is a subset of ML that uses artificial neural networks with multiple layers.

10.2. Can you provide real-world examples of AI in use today?

Examples include:

  • Healthcare: AI-powered diagnostic tools
  • Finance: Fraud detection systems
  • Transportation: Autonomous vehicles
  • Retail: Personalized shopping recommendations
  • Education: Personalized learning platforms

10.3. What are the key benefits of using machine learning?

Key benefits include:

  • Automation: Automating repetitive tasks
  • Prediction: Making accurate predictions based on data
  • Personalization: Providing personalized experiences
  • Efficiency: Improving efficiency and productivity

10.4. How is deep learning different from traditional machine learning?

Deep learning automates feature extraction, reduces the need for manual feature engineering, and can handle more complex problems.

10.5. What are some of the challenges in developing AI solutions?

Challenges include:

  • Data availability: Requiring large amounts of data for training
  • Computational resources: Needing significant computing power
  • Ethical considerations: Addressing bias, privacy, and job displacement

10.6. What is the role of neural networks in deep learning?

Neural networks are the foundation of deep learning. They consist of interconnected nodes (neurons) organized in layers that process and learn from data.

10.7. What are some popular deep learning frameworks?

Popular frameworks include TensorFlow, PyTorch, and Keras.

10.8. How can I get started with learning AI, ML, and DL?

  • Online courses: Platforms like Coursera, edX, and Udacity offer courses on AI, ML, and DL.
  • Books: “Hands-On Machine Learning with Scikit-Learn, Keras & TensorFlow” by Aurélien Géron is a popular choice.
  • Tutorials: Websites like Towards Data Science and Machine Learning Mastery provide tutorials and articles.

10.9. What are the ethical considerations in AI development?

Ethical considerations include:

  • Bias: Ensuring fairness and avoiding discrimination
  • Privacy: Protecting personal data
  • Transparency: Making AI systems understandable
  • Accountability: Establishing responsibility for AI decisions

10.10. How is AI used in the education sector?

AI is used in the education sector for:

  • Personalized learning: Adapting to individual student needs
  • Automated grading: Reducing teacher workload
  • AI tutors: Providing personalized support and guidance
  • Content creation: Generating educational materials

At LEARNS.EDU.VN, we offer comprehensive resources and courses to help you explore these exciting fields.

Unlock Your Potential with AI, ML, and DL Education at LEARNS.EDU.VN

Ready to dive deeper into the world of Artificial Intelligence, Machine Learning, and Deep Learning? At LEARNS.EDU.VN, we provide the resources and guidance you need to succeed. From beginner-friendly introductions to advanced techniques, our courses are designed to empower you with the knowledge and skills to excel in these cutting-edge fields.

Don’t let the complexity of AI hold you back. Visit LEARNS.EDU.VN today and discover how you can transform your future with AI, ML, and DL.

Contact us:

  • Address: 123 Education Way, Learnville, CA 90210, United States
  • WhatsApp: +1 555-555-1212
  • Website: learns.edu.vn

Comments

No comments yet. Why don’t you start the discussion?

Leave a Reply

Your email address will not be published. Required fields are marked *